Titan Wrecking & Environmental LLC

Open
Call

Advertisement

262 Woodward Ave
Buffalo, NY 14217
Own this business?
See a problem?

You might also like

United StatesNew YorkBuffaloTitan Wrecking & Environmental LLC

Advertisement